Builders Guild

The Builders Guild is dedicated to the design and build of sets, scenery and drops for our productions. We provide input to the leadership re: technical and tool capability needs, space considerations, and storage options. The work is typically scheduled in the weeks preceding a show, coordinating with the Set Designer and Master Carpenter to ensure we provide appropriate skillsets, manpower and even necessary training, depending upon the vision and scope of the build. We appreciate any interest, especially encouraging persons with skills in carpentry and custom fabrication—or an interest in learning on-the-job-- to join us in making the Baldwin stage come alive!

Hospitality

House Managers work with ushers to make each patron’s visit pleasant, comfortable and safe. They greet and seat audience members, serve refreshments and prepare the auditorium and lobby for the next performance. We are trained to be ambassadors for Stagecrafters and in resolving issues which may arise, such as duplicate tickets, and provide assistive hearing devices, pillows, or whatever makes the patron feel welcome and valued. House managers and ushers are encouraged to receive training on the use of our AED machine.

Costumes/Wardrobe

Costumers provide various types of costumes for Main Stage, 2nd Stage and SYT (youth theatre productions. Costumers may design and create (“build”), rent or buy costumes, depending types of costumes required (animals), period and vision of the director. Members do not necessarily need to sew – there are many tasks that one might do, including cutting out patterns, selecting or organizing costumes for sale, organizing patterns, or even small tasks such as sewing on buttons.

Sound

We design and/or run sound for productions, including orchestra, vocals, dialogue and sound effects. We mix sound to achieve the best possible delivery to the audience. We maintain microphones, cords, speakers and other supplies in the sound room. We ensure security of the equipment in the sound room when working on a production. Experienced sound people provide orientation and, often, mentoring of new sound people.

About us Stagecrafters, a 501 (c)(3) not-for-profit community theatre, provides opportunities for members of the community to develop their talents and to volunteer their time to create an enriching, quality theatrical experience through its Main Stage, 2nd Stage, and Youth Theatre productions. Founded in 1956, Stagecrafters has been named "Best Community Theatre" by Hour Detroit Magazine readers, and "Best Place for Live Local Theatre" by Detroit Metro Times readers. Recently, the 2nd Stage show "Trevor" won awards at the 2017 Michigan AACTFEST in the categories of Outstanding Featured Actor, Outstanding Actor and the Golden Truck Award.
